Untitled (two little boys with toy car and tugboat) c. 1950
Dimensions 10.16 x 12.7 cm (4 x 5 in.)
Editor: This photograph, "Untitled (two little boys with toy car and tugboat)" by Lucian and Mary Brown, shows two children at play. It's small, monochromatic, and the composition, with its stark contrast, is quite striking. What formal qualities stand out to you? Curator: The most compelling feature is the manipulation of light and shadow. Observe how the inversion of tones creates a sense of otherworldliness. It invites a deeper consideration of surface texture and tonal relationships. Does this inversion alter your perception of the subjects? Editor: It does create a sense of distance, despite the intimate subject matter. It's less about capturing a moment and more about abstracting it. Thank you. Curator: Precisely. Consider how the alteration transforms the mundane into a study of form and light. It's a powerful demonstration of the photograph as an object of art, not merely a record.
